Description

LED light strip
Technical field
The utility model belongs to technology of semiconductor illumination application field, and in particular to a kind of LED light strip.
Background technology
With the fast development of LED lighting technology, LED soft light rope is as a kind of energy saving, efficient, environmentally friendly and intelligentized Illuminating product has been widely used in the fields such as house ornamentation illumination, commercial illumination and landscape light in city.
LED light strip of the prior art has the following problems mostly:1. due to the particularity of its application field, then to its institute Encapsulating material proposes the high requirement of comparison, the mechanical property of the encapsulating material of existing LED light strip, bent toughness and resistance to Time property is not all right, otherwise see-through property there is also it is certain the problem of, seriously affect the intensity of illumination of LED lamp bead;2. each LED lamp bead Hot spot or shadow can be shown on housing, illumination uniformity is poor, and aesthetics is not high;3. the heat accumulation of light bar is very fast, heat dissipation More slowly LED lamp bead scaling loss is easy to cause, influences to use.
Utility model content
In view of the deficienciess of the prior art, the utility model provides, a kind of bent toughness is strong, corrosion-resistant strong, uniform illumination And the good LED light strip of heat dissipation.
The utility model is achieved through the following technical solutions:
A kind of LED light strip including encapsulated layer, is provided with flexible circuit board in the encapsulated layer, in the flexible circuit board Several LED lamp beads are evenly equipped with, the tip shroud of the LED lamp bead is equipped with filter layer, is set between the LED lamp bead and flexible circuit board Heat-conducting glue layer is equipped with, is located in the heat-conducting glue layer immediately below the LED lamp bead and is provided with heat dissipation patch.
Further, the lower surface of the encapsulated layer is provided with glass layer.
Further, the colloid of light transmission is filled between the encapsulated layer and flexible circuit board.
Further, the heat dissipation patch uses aluminium flake.
Further, the encapsulated layer uses polyurethane elastomer.
Compared with prior art, the beneficial effects of the utility model are:
1st, the utility model encapsulated layer uses polyurethane elastomer, and light transmittance is more than 90%, does not interfere with LED lamp bead Intensity of illumination, also with good high and low temperature resistance, cementability is strong, and mechanical strength is low, has good bent toughness, meets The various demands using specification, the service life and use scope of effective guarantee the utility model entirety;
2nd, the tip shroud of the utility model LED lamp bead is equipped with filter layer so that the light that LED lamp bead is sent is after optical filtering It realizes good light uniformity, effectively overcomes and encapsulating the problem of layer surface forms hot spot shade;
3rd, it is located in the utility model heat-conducting glue layer immediately below LED lamp bead and is provided with radiation aluminium patch, effectively by LED The heat of lamp bead accumulation is distributed, and reduces the heat of LED lamp bead, extends its service life, reduces use cost.
Description of the drawings
Fig. 1 is the structure diagram of the utility model.
In attached drawing:1. encapsulated layer;2. flexible circuit board;3.LED lamp beads;4. colloid;5. filter layer;6. heat conduction silicone; 7. radiate patch;8. glass layer.
Specific embodiment
A kind of LED light strip as shown in Figure 1, including encapsulated layer 1, is provided with flexible circuit board 2, flexible wires in encapsulated layer 1 Be evenly equipped with several LED lamp beads 3 on road plate 2, the tip shroud of LED lamp bead 3 is equipped with filter layer 5, LED lamp bead 3 and flexible circuit board 2 it Between be provided with heat-conducting glue layer 6, be located in heat-conducting glue layer 6 immediately below LED lamp bead and be provided with heat dissipation patch 7.
Further, the lower surface of encapsulated layer 1 is provided with glass layer 8.
Further, the colloid 4 of light transmission is filled between encapsulated layer 1 and flexible circuit board 2.
Further, the patch 7 that radiates uses aluminium flake.
Further, encapsulated layer 1 uses polyurethane elastomer.
